Overview
This role is predominately homebased with the need to travel to meetings approximately once a month.

How will you contribute?

  • Triage and prioritisation of all payroll incidents
  • Respond and resolve all payroll Incidents raised.
  • Managing related incidents as problems.
  • Monitoring all integrations with Oracle Payroll and raising incidents with IT Support.
  • Allocating incidents to identified Support Consultants.
  • Carrying out root cause analysis for all incidents.
  • Raising required changes for review and implementation following RCA.
  • The collation and publishing of all Payroll Support KPI's.
  • Liaises with the people/management teams when something goes wrong with payroll due to a process or system issues, provides a recovery plan and lesson learnt document for every case.
  • Supports T & A and payroll related projects as and when required.
  • Produces and supplies adhoc summary reporting and statistical information on payroll data.
